Power That Packs a Punch: Toyota New Hiace 2025

Under the hood, the 2025 HiAce is a beast. It’s powered by a 2.8-liter turbo-diesel engine pumping out 130 kW of power and up to 450 Nm of torque with its six-speed automatic transmission. That’s enough muscle to tow up to 1,500 kg with a braked trailer or 400 kg unbraked, perfect for small businesses or weekend warriors. Plus, it sips diesel at just 8.2L/100km in mixed driving, so you’re not burning cash at the pump.

Specification Details
Engine 2.8L Turbo-Diesel
Power 130 kW @ 3400 rpm
Torque 450 Nm @ 1400 rpm (auto)
Fuel Economy 8.2L/100km (combined)
Towing Capacity 1500 kg (braked), 400 kg (unbraked)
Transmission Six-speed Auto Sequential

Tech That Keeps You Connected

Step inside, and the HiAce feels like a tech upgrade. You’ve got an 8-inch touchscreen with wireless Apple CarPlay and Android Auto—say goodbye to messy cords! A 7-inch digital driver’s display keeps all your info, like speed and fuel, right where you need it. For businesses, Toyota’s Connected Services hooks you up with the myToyota Connect app for free for the first year, giving you navigation, safety alerts, and driving insights. Safety That’s Got You Covered

Safety’s a big deal with this van. The 2025 HiAce comes loaded with Toyota Safety Sense, including adaptive cruise control to keep you steady in traffic and lane-centering assist to nudge you back if you drift. It’s got up to 10 airbags, including a new front-center one, so everyone’s protected. Automatic emergency braking and blind-spot monitoring help you avoid trouble, whether you’re dodging city traffic or cruising the highway. It’s peace of mind for you and your crew.

Built for Work and Play

This van’s a workhorse with a heart for adventure. The long-wheelbase (LWB) and super-long-wheelbase (SLWB) options give you up to 9.3 cubic meters of cargo space—plenty for tools, gear, or even a DIY camper setup. Need to carry people? The Crew Van configuration has flexible seating for your team or family. With a five-year, unlimited-kilometer warranty (or 160,000 km for commercial use), this HiAce is built to last, whether you’re a tradie or a road-trip junkie.
